 RALLY ROUND THE TRADE NAME A business name is a name that identifies a company or a business. The legal registration application can sometimes be different from the trade name. Trade name infringement is a violation of exclusive rights which belong to a registered company or organization. This violation is a critical offense to owners of businesses, especially the successful ones. This is due to the fact that they have spent a lot of money in creating a strong image in order to attract customers. If another company uses the same name it is bound to steer conflict between the companies (Rally round the trade name, 2011). The common law allows a business or company which uses a particular trade name first, in a given geographical area to have exclusive rights in the usage of the name, and the intended purposes. This protects Rally motors in case of losses which might arise as a result of damaged image or consumer conflicts. These damages could come from confusion as we saw in the video where customers were calling Rally Motors to place their delivery orders for pizza (Amanda, 2002). 3. Explain how important the fact is that Herman started to use the name Rally first in that particular geographical area. Under the common law of the land, Herman is safe since he was the first one to use the name in the geographical area, some forty years ago. His protection is by registration of business name. Herman is protected under all of these laws. Common law states that who first uses the name, in a given specific geographical area and for a specific or determined purpose protection will be offered. Furthermore, registration of a name as a trading name with the United States patent office or the recorder of the county protects the trade name from any other business owner. Additionally it declares that the trade name can not be used by any other company or business in the jurisdiction where the name after registration dates (Amanda, 2002). In case Herman had not registered the trade name Rally, the law would still protect him as he was the first one to use the name. 4. Explain what rights you have in your trade name When a company has its own trade name, it gets several rights and advantages. The company has the right to market itself in preferential geographic areas where the ability for expansion is greater, and so is the market target. When the name has been registered, no other business can register it, either intentionally or not, because this can be stopped by a court injunctive (James, 2004). The name also prevents other businesses selling the same product or using the same name in your area of jurisdiction. The name is exclusive to its pioneers alone. 5. Explain what remedies you have if someone else infringes upon your trade name Infringement of one's business name is a crime that can be charged both in a state and at federal level. In federal law, the name infringement law is contained in Lehman trademark act, but in state law it is protected by common law and property statutes and doctrines. If a business infringes, the affected business can sue and ask for monetary compensation in a court for all the losses incurred after using this name (James, 2004).
